Railways utilises ₹1.14 lakh crore, 39% of FY27 Budget allocation till July

Indian Railways has utilised more than ₹1.14 lakh crore, nearly 39 per cent of its Budget allocation of ₹2.93 lakh crore for 2026-27, till July this year, while continuing to expand investments in safety, infrastructure and capacity enhancement, the government informed Parliament on Wednesday. Railways approves major fibre network, Kavach expansion projects worth ₹1,236 crore

Indian Railways has approved a series of infrastructure projects worth ₹1,236 crore aimed at strengthening its communication systems and expanding the indigenous Kavach train protection system across key routes. The approvals cover three proposals focusing on optical fibre network expansion and deployment of the Kavach automatic train protection system across Central, Western, and Southern Railway zones. Indian Railways operates 244 special trains during Mauni Amavasya, ferries over 4.5 lakh passengers in just 2 weeks

Indian Railways successfully managed the surge in passenger traffic during the Mauni Amavasya period by operating 244 special trains across the country over the past two weeks, ferrying more than 4.5 lakh devotees without disrupting regular services. According to the Ministry of Railways, the special trains have been running since January 3, and were operated by three railway zones—31 trains by Northern Railway (NR), 158 by North Central Railway (NCR), and 55 by North Eastern Railway (NER). Dense fog disrupts air and rail services across north India; 128 flights cancelled at Delhi airport

Flight and train operations across several parts of the country were severely disrupted on Monday as dense fog reduced visibility, leaving thousands of passengers stranded at Delhi’s Indira Gandhi International (IGI) Airport. At Delhi airport alone, a total of 128 flights were cancelled, including 64 arrivals and 64 departures.
